I have an odd problem with the numbering of tables. The document I've written includes an Appendix with tables and figures. The numbering for the tables omits A.2 and jumps directly from Table A.1 to A.3 and then continues on normally, A.4 etc. This only occurs for tables and not for figures. I'm using Lyx 1.4.1 for Mac btw.

Does anyone have an idea how I could fix this?
This happens if you have two captions inside a float.  (Which may
be a valid thing to do, for example when having two numbered
tables side-by-side.)

This sometimes happens accidentally like this:
1. You insert a table float. The empty paragraph inside the new float
  is of type "caption"
2. During editing, the caption paragraph is split by pressing enter.
   Now there are two paragraphs in there, both of type "caption".
   Perhaps one is the real caption and the other contains the table.

The paragraph containing the table (or figure) inside a float should
not be of the "caption" type.
